The Construction of Your Gutter Guard

Size and shape should be one of the first things you look for when buying new gutter covers as you’d like them to be compatible with your existing gutter system. You’ll want to think about how the gutter guards keep debris out – the best gutter covers repel solid debris while allowing water to easily stream down the surface and into the gutters.


Also consider that the materials used may affect compatibility: some leaf gutter guards are made out of plastic or soft metals; others use sturdier metals such as aluminum or steel.

Lifespan of the Gutter Guards

Even the best gutter guards require maintenance from time to time, no matter which kind you choose. The next step is to decide how often you expect to maintain or replace them, depending on their expected lifespan.


So how long do gutter guards last? The main factor determining your gutter covers’ longevity is whether you opt for a store-bought guards or a comprehensive leaf gutter guard system. Many consumers are attracted to the store-bought kind as they are not as expensive as comprehensive gutter guard products. However, these will require gutter guard repairs more often and need to be replaced every few years. On the other hand, the comprehensive option lasts anywhere from 10 to 25 years or even longer, which may be worth the investment to you.

Types of Gutter Guards

Leaf gutter guards not only keep the gutters clear of debris, but they also make maintenance simple. They do this in a variety of ways, depending on the types of gutter guards you’re looking at.


For example, gutter guards with screens are increasingly prevalent and come in a variety of designs and sizes. The best gutter screens for your home are ones with holes small enough to keep out both the animals and natural debris common to your area. If you live in an area with pine needles, dust, or other fine debris, consider clean mesh gutter guards instead.


Foam insert and brush gutter guard types are less durable and need to be maintained more frequently. But, they can still get the job done for homes across the country at a lower initial price.


Surface tension gutter guards (also known as reverse curve guards) are angled down and have a textured top surface. This increases the surface tension of the water to cling to the guard as it runs over the top surface and into the narrow groove to the gutter. They are also the best professionally installed gutter guards and pay off with their increased durability, maximum effectiveness, and little maintenance.

What is Your Budget?

The consideration that’s most often top of mind is, of course, gutter guard cost. Remember that as with most things, the amount you’re willing to spend will likely indicate the level of quality you’ll receive. So, the cheapest gutter guards may end up costing you more in the long run (as we discussed regarding lifespan).

 

For example, foam or brush inserts cost about half as much per linear foot compared to mesh or surface tension gutter guards. Those higher prices take into account increased durability and strong warranty protection.
